Air pollution in hospitals is an important vector for hospital-acquired infections. How to improve the medical environment in hospitals, especially the air quality in special places in hospitals such as operating rooms, intensive care units and other departments, is particularly important for infectious disease prevention and control and hospital infection control. At a time when COVID-19 is ravaging the world, it is of even greater relevance. Disinfection technology | Mechanism of action | Pros and cons |
---|---|---|
AOP-KF® solid alkali | Using its strong oxidizing property, it destroys the micro-enzyme system, oxidizes and decomposes toxic substances such as formaldehyde. | Advantages: active sterilization, low dosage, fast action, non-toxic, harmless, no residue, no secondary pollution, 360-degree sterilization and disinfection without dead ends; a small amount of atomic oxygen released can also play a role in fresh air |
Plasma | The plasma matrix is used to form a high-voltage electrostatic field to decompose and destroy the negatively charged bacteria, so as to achieve the purpose of sterilization. | Disadvantages: It must be cleaned regularly, otherwise the efficiency will be significantly reduced; because of the high-voltage discharge, toxic ozone will be generated. |
Ozone | The oxidizing property of ozone is used to achieve the effect of sterilization and disinfection, which is active sterilization. |
Advantages:
rapid purification effect, broad-spectrum sterilization.
Disadvantages: Strict requirements for ozone concentration, difficult to control, and people and machines cannot be in the same room. |
Ultraviolet rays | It mainly acts on the DNA of microorganisms, destroys the DNA structure, and makes it lose the function of reproduction and self-replication to achieve the purpose of sterilization and disinfection. |
Advantages:
convenience, no pollution to the environment, no residual toxic substances.
Disadvantages: The effect is inversely proportional to the distance and area, only the surface of the object can be sterilized, which is harmful to the human body, and cannot be shared by humans and machines. |
Photocatalyst | Under the irradiation of light, a photocatalytic reaction similar to photosynthesis will occur, and free hydroxyl groups and active oxygen groups with strong oxidizing ability will be produced. It can destroy the cell membrane of bacteria and the protein that solidifies the virus, which can kill bacteria and decompose organic pollutants | Disadvantages: Nano particles have a strong penetrating power to cells, and inhalation of the human body is likely to cause great harm. At present, some scientists have proposed to use nanotechnology with caution. |
Negative ion | Using DC high voltage to generate high corona, release a large number of electrons at high speed, together with oxygen molecules in the air, form negative ions and diffuse outward |
Advantages:
Negative ions are good for human health, can enhance disease resistance, promote metabolism, improve human sleep and so on.
Disadvantages: Negative ions last for a short time in the air, cannot be sterilized, do not decompose harmful substances, and are ineffective against peculiar smells. |
Activated carbon | It is a commonly used air purification material, which uses the porous structure of bamboo charcoal to adsorb traces of toxic gases in the air. |
Advantages:
Easy to use
Disadvantages: Passive physical adsorption is mainly used, and the adsorption capacity for long-distance pollutants is weak, and the adsorption capacity is limited, which is easy to cause secondary pollution. |
